Thermally Conductive Insulating Sheets for Packaging are sheet-type thermal interface materials used between power devices, IC packages, module housings, and heat sinks. They are typically manufactured by incorporating electrically insulating and thermally conductive fillers such as aluminum oxide, boron nitride, or aluminum nitride into silicone rubber, acrylic, or thermosetting resin matrices. Glass fiber fabrics or polyimide films may also be added to enhance dielectric strength, puncture resistance, and assembly stability. The overall gross margin is approximately 43%.
Demand for thermally conductive insulating sheets is primarily driven by the transition of high-power-density electronic packaging toward automotive-grade, high-frequency, and miniaturized applications. Electric vehicle inverters, onboard chargers, server power supplies, communication base stations, and industrial power systems all require effective thermal management and electrical isolation within limited space. Compared with thermal grease and conventional thermal pads, thin high-dielectric-strength sheets are easier to standardize for automated assembly and mass production.
Market competition is shifting from a focus on thermal conductivity alone toward a comprehensive balance of low thermal resistance, dielectric strength, low stress, and long-term reliability. High-end products increasingly emphasize the orientation control and high-loading processing of electrically insulating fillers such as boron nitride and aluminum nitride. Reinforced structures incorporating glass fiber fabrics or polyimide films also continue to maintain stable demand in power modules and high-voltage power supply applications.
